    \textit{R. Selten}'s concept of ``perfect equilibrium'' [Int. J. Game Theory 4, 25-55 (1975; Zbl 0312.90072)] is compared with the author's new concept of ``lexicographic undominated'' mixed strategy for non- cooperative games in normal form. It is shown that, in general, perfect equilibria are lexicographically undominated, but the converse is not always true. A local characterization of lexicographically undominated Nash equilibria is also given.
